Choosing the Right Salon for Your Beauty Room

Finding the perfect beauty room to rent in a salon can be challenging. Consider essential factors to make an informed decision:

  • Location: Choose a salon located in a high-traffic area to maximize visibility and client footfall.
  • Salon's Reputation: Research the salon's reputation in the beauty community; a well-respected salon can significantly enhance your credibility.
  • Available Amenities: Evaluate what facilities and amenities are included with the room rental to ensure that your professional needs will be met.
  • Lease Terms: Carefully review the lease terms. Ensure they align with your business goals and provide room for growth.

Challenges to Consider When Renting a Beauty Room

While there are numerous benefits to renting, it's important to also consider potential challenges:

  • Limited Control: While you enjoy the freedom of running your service, you're still subject to the salon's overall policies and rules.
  • Potentially Higher Rent: Depending on the location and demand, rental costs can vary, and sometimes you may pay a premium for a prime location.
  • Shared Clientele: There may be competition for clients within the same salon, so collaboration and effective marketing strategies are essential.
